The skeletal remains of a missing person were discovered in Barangay Camansi, Kabankalan City while a fisherman was found dead along the shoreline of Himamaylan City in Negros Occidental on May 31.

Initial police investigation showed that alias “Joey”, 19, a resident of Sitio Bayog, was reported missing by his father Joey since May 5.

Alias “Gino” found the skeletal remains while he was gathering firewood at Purok 1 in Barangay Camansi.

Before the victim had gone missing, his father told the police that his son was suffering from depression.

Meanwhile, a 42-year-old fisherman identified only by the police as alias “Ruben” was found dead along the shoreline of Purok II in Barangay Saraet.

The victim was reported to have been in a drinking session with his neighbor on Friday night.

He may have fallen from the seaport and succumbed to bruises in the head, the police said.

The Himamaylan City police has requested a post-mortem examination to determine the cause of death of the victim. | GB
